', $data); self::assertSame(64, substr_count($data, 'load($filename); $sheet = $spreadsheet->getActiveSheet(); self::assertSame('00FFFFFF', $sheet->getCell('A3')->getStyle()->getFill()->getStartColor()->getArgb()); self::assertSame('00F0FBFF', $sheet->getCell('A1')->getStyle()->getFill()->getStartColor()->getArgb()); self::assertSame('00F0F0F0', $sheet->getCell('B1')->getStyle()->getFill()->getStartColor()->getArgb()); $spreadsheet->disconnectWorksheets(); } public function testPreliminaries3093(): void { $file = 'zip://'; $file .= self::$testbook3093; $file .= '#xl/styles.xml'; $data = file_get_contents($file); // confirm that file contains expected color index tag if ($data === false) { self::fail('Unable to read file'); } else { self::assertStringContainsString('', $data); self::assertSame(15, substr_count($data, 'load($filename); $sheet = $spreadsheet->getActiveSheet(); self::assertSame('ffc0c0c0', $sheet->getCell('B2')->getStyle()->getFill()->getStartColor()->getArgb()); self::assertSame('ffffff00', $sheet->getCell('D2')->getStyle()->getFill()->getStartColor()->getArgb()); self::assertSame('ffdfa7a6', $sheet->getCell('F2')->getStyle()->getFill()->getStartColor()->getArgb()); self::assertSame('ff7ba0cd', $sheet->getCell('H2')->getStyle()->getFill()->getStartColor()->getArgb()); $spreadsheet->disconnectWorksheets(); } }